When adding and removing items in a @for loop, the animate.leave event binding instruction was not updated to use the same logic as the class function when the animation queue was added. We were not returning the correct signature for the animate.leave function, which caused the animation to not trigger correctly. This updates the event binding instruction to use the same logic as the class function when adding the animation to the queue.

fixes: #64336
